Foxtable(狐表)用户栏目专家坐堂 → 日期格式转换问题


  共有1473人关注过本帖平板打印复制链接

主题:日期格式转换问题

帅哥哟,离线,有人找我吗?
victor_lin33
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:159 积分:1436 威望:0 精华:0 注册:2016/3/24 19:00:00
日期格式转换问题  发帖心情 Post By:2017/2/12 16:19:00 [只看该作者]

老师:过年好....祝您2017年 万事如意

我在"出货明细"表 DATACOLCHENGED写了下列代码

Dim dr As DataRow = e.DataRow
Dim pr As DataRow
pr = DataTables("称重档").Find("[流水号] = '" & dr("流水号") & "'")        
If pr IsNot Nothing Then '如果找到的话
   dr("净重") = pr("净重")
   dr("出货日期") = pr("毛重时间")
   dr("车号") = pr("车号")
   dr("装货属性") = pr("备用1")
End If

但是"秤重档"的 [毛重时间] 是 DATETIME 类型的格式(例: 2017-01-01 23:59)
我需要 dr("出货日期") = pr("毛重时间") 这个代码能让原来"秤重档"的 [毛重时间]  DATETIME 类型带到"出货明细"直接转成 DATE类型
我尝试用 dr("出货日期") = pr("毛重时间").date 但是作不成功
把"出货明细"的出货日期列设置成字符型→再用  dr("出货日期") = pr("毛重时间").SubString(0,9)
还是不行,只好请老师指点一下....
谢谢!

注→因领导喜欢用EXCEL的枢纽分析表,所以必须是存到TABLE时是DATE (例: 2017-01-01)的类型,不是把仅仅把"出货明细"的出货日期列设置成DATE类型就可以....

 回到顶部